GoLand 2026.1 for Mac 评测:Go 1.26 语法现代化工具和 AI 代理支持让我多看了几眼

Goland 2026 2026.1

Mac 上直接装好 2026.1 版本后的第一感觉

前阵子 JetBrains 发布了 GoLand 2026.1,我在 MacBook 上赶紧下了那个 .dmg 文件,分 Intel 和 Apple Silicon 两个版本,拖进 Applications 就完事了。安装过程没什么可挑剔的,打开后界面还是老样子,但总觉得哪里顺手了点。尤其是 M 系列芯片的 Mac,用起来流畅度挺高,没遇到什么卡顿或者兼容问题,这点对我们这些天天敲代码的人来说其实挺重要的。

Goland 2026 2026.1 for Mac 破解版下载

我本来只是想试试新功能,结果一用就停不下来了。GoLand 作为 Go 开发者的主力 IDE,这次更新重点放在了让代码跟上 Go 1.26 的节奏上,还有 AI 和云相关的改进。想想以前升级 Go 版本时得手动搜半天过时语法,现在 IDE 直接帮忙,确实省心不少。

Go 1.26 支持到底怎么帮你现代化整个代码库

这次最让我有印象的就是 Go 1.26 语法更新的那套工具了。不是随便高亮一下,而是真正扫描你的项目,在编辑器里直接标出那些还能优化的地方,配上专用图标和解释。比方说用 new() 来创建指针,以前手动写 &T{} 那种,现在 IDE 建议换成更现代的写法;还有 errors.AsType 这种类型安全的错误解包方式,也能一键修复。快速修复按钮点一下就行,如果想整个项目批量搞,Problems 工具窗口里会把所有 Syntax updates 列出来,支持预览 diff,选好再应用,不会乱改代码。

我试着在一个中等规模的项目里跑了跑这个流程,发现它真的挺智能的。go.mod 里一指定 Go 1.26,IDE 就自动提示你去更新语法。Search Everywhere 里搜 Update Syntax 也能直接启动,或者从 Refactor 菜单进去。以前我总担心大代码库升级会出意外,现在有了分组审查和差异视图,心里踏实多了。尤其对 Mac 用户来说,窗口切换少,专注力更容易保持,这功能用着用着就觉得离不开。

AI 代理支持扩展后开发体验变了

AI 部分这次也升级了,支持 GitHub Copilot、Cursor 还有其他 ACP 兼容的智能体。以前 GoLand 就有自己的 AI 助手,现在通过 Agent Client Protocol 能接更多外部代理,还有个 ACP Registry 可以一键发现和安装各种智能体。说实话,我之前用 AI 写点辅助代码时总觉得选项少,现在选择面宽了,任务不同挑不同的代理试试,效率确实往上提了点。

在 Mac 上用聊天窗口跟 AI 互动,响应速度还行,没感觉到延迟拖后腿。尤其是调试或者生成 boilerplate 时,让代理帮忙,省下的时间够我多喝两口咖啡了。当然效果还是看具体代理,但 IDE 集成得挺自然,不用额外折腾插件。

Terraform Stacks 和云基础设施工作流顺了不少

做云原生或者基础设施即代码的朋友应该会喜欢 Terraform Stacks 的原生支持。在 GoLand 里就能直接管理这些 stacks,代码补全、结构洞察、创建组件和部署都集成进来了,组件间导航也快。以前我得切到 Terraform 专用工具,现在全在 IDE 里搞定,上下文切换少了很多。对 Mac 的多窗口管理来说,这点小改进其实挺实用的,不会让桌面乱成一锅粥。

另外还提了原生 Wayland 支持,不过那是 Linux 的事,Mac 上主要还是享受整体工作流的优化。容器化开发环境现在用起来更舒服了点,我在项目里试了试,感觉基础设施相关的代码编辑没以前那么割裂。

Git worktrees 支持和编辑器小优化

Git worktrees 的第一类支持也加进来了,这功能对大仓库特别友好。能同时开几个独立的 worktree 处理不同分支,比如主线继续开发,另一个专门搞 hotfix,或者让 AI 代理跑任务,都不用来回切换分支或者 stash 代码。Mac 上配合终端切换目录挺顺的,省下的时间真的能积累成生产力。

编辑器本身也改了改,光标动画现在更平滑,选择行为优化过后,用着没那么生硬。整体体验干净流畅,我敲代码时偶尔会注意到这些细节,舒服是舒服,但不会抢戏。Code With Me 这次从内置功能里移出去了,变成 Marketplace 上的独立插件,最后官方支持就是 2026.1 版,以后协作需求得另外装,不过对大部分人来说影响不算大。

用下来我发现 GoLand 2026.1 for Mac 在抓住 Go 语言最新变化的同时,还把开发者日常痛点一个个补上。尤其是那些跟进 Go 1.26 的项目,或者爱用 AI 辅助的,更新后多半会觉得值回票价。反正我现在日常开发已经切到这个版本了,感觉后续迭代应该会更有趣。

Related Posts

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注